We think it is important that people can share their experiences of the NHS in their own words.
There have been lots of changes and challenges happening in the NHS due to the ongoing Covid-19 pandemic since March 2020. It is now more than ever, important for the ICB to get an understanding of what impact these changes have had on people and where improvements need to be made.
By sharing your experiences of the NHS since March 2020, you can help health care professionals and the ICB to understand what was good, what was bad and what would have made your experience better.
How to share your NHS experience - There are various ways you can share your experiences. Please see below:
- Online form - You can tell us your about your NHS experience by following this link to a short survey. The full survey link: https://www.surveymonkey.com/r/PExNHS
- By telephone or video call - Contact the engagement team at hw.engage@nhs.net to arrange to speak to someone on the telephone or by video call.
